Who Decides

A pause is for thought, 
or just to remember
in case you forgot.

A loss is forever,
and lies far beyond
that crossed over point.

A choice is a dilemma
to go left or go right,
to be good or be bad,
to continue or hide,
it can’t be avoided
you have to decide.

Unless there are two points of view,
to be considered, then who decides?
